Director articol
Nu vă puteți conecta la Vultr VPS SSH?
Metoda de configurare pentru generarea cheii PuTTY
Pentru că mulți internauți chinezi folosesc Vultr VPS pentru a construi "științăInternet”, astfel încât un număr mare de adrese IP ale lui Vultr au fost blocate...
Detectați adresa IP
În primul rând, trebuie să confirmați că ați creat adresa IP a Vultr. O puteți accesa în China continentală ca de obicei?
Soluţie:
- Utilizați un instrument de ping online pentru a detecta adrese IP ▼
Ce ar trebui să fac dacă adresa mea IP Vultr este blocată în China continentală?
- Consultați acest articol pentru soluția ▼
Autentificare cu cheia SSH
În timp ce VPS-ul este expus la internet, cineva va continua să forțeze parola dvs. SSH pentru a vă conecta.
Prin urmare, este necesar să vă conectați cu cheile SSH și să dezactivați autentificarea prin parolă.
Utilizați următoarea comandă pentru a vedea conexiunile de forță brută ale altor persoane pentru parola dvs. SSH:
grep "Failed password for invalid user" /var/log/secure | awk '{print $13}' | sort | uniq -c | sort -nr | more
Pentru propriul VPS achiziționat, forță brută de până la mii de ori!Poți să mergi și să vezi de câte ori ai fost forțat.
Soluţie:
- Schimbați modul de conectare cu parola SSH în modul de conectare cu cheia SSH
Generarea cheii SSH
Dacă este un sistem Windows, trebuie să utilizați puttygen 软件pentru a genera o pereche de chei.
Linux și sistemele MacOS pot fi rulate direct de pe terminal:
pasul 1:Generați chei SSH
Rulați această comandă ▼
ssh-keygen -t rsa -b 4096
pasul 2:Introduceți locația fișierului pentru a salva cheia
Enter file in which to save the key (/root/.ssh/id_rsa):
- Vă rugăm să apăsați Enter
pasul 3:Vi se va cere să introduceți o parolă
Enter passphrase (empty for no passphrase): Enter same passphrase again:
- Introduceți o parolă sau puteți pur și simplu să apăsați Enter și să o lăsați necompletată.
La sfârșit, veți vedea un mesaj că cheile dvs. private și publice sunt stocate acolo:
Your identification has been saved in /root/.ssh/id_rsa. <== 私钥 Your public key has been saved in /root/.ssh/id_rsa.pub. <== 公钥
Vultr VPS Configura SSH
Când Vultr creează un VPS, puteți configura direct autentificarea cu cheia SSH.
Dacă ați creat un VPS, dar nu ați configurat chei SSH...
Vă rugăm să urmați pașii de mai jos după ce rulați „generarea cheii SSH” de mai sus pe Linux:
第 1 步 :voi id_rsa.pub
pus într-un /root/.ssh
director și redenumiți-l în authorized_keys
pasul 2:modifica /etc/ssh/sshd_config
Fișier de configurare
RSAAuthentication yes #RSA认证 PubkeyAuthentication yes #开启公钥验证 AuthorizedKeysFile .ssh/authorized_keys #验证文件路径 PasswordAuthentication no #禁止密码认证 PermitEmptyPasswords no #禁止空密码
pasul 3:Reporniți serviciul SSH
- cenți7 Folosiți comanda:
systemctl restart sshd
- Centos6 folosește comanda:
/etc/init.d/sshd restart
PuTTY generează chei
Dacă utilizați un sistem Windows pentru a vă conecta la VPS, va trebui să descărcați cheia privată pe client și să o convertiți în formatul folosit de PuTTY.
- Nu aveți software-ul PuTTY instalat pe computer?Vă rugăm să căutați pe Google sau Baidu: descărcați PuTTY.
第 1 步 :Folosind WinSCP, SFTP sau alte instrumente, transferați fișierul cheii private id_rsa Descărcați la client.
第 2 步 :Deschideți PuTTYGen.exe
第 3 步 :Faceți clic pe butonul Încărcare din Acțiuni ▼
第 4 步 :Încărcați fișierul cheie privată pe care tocmai l-ați descărcat
Nu se poate afișa fișierul cheii private?Vă rugăm să selectați „Toate fișierele (*.*)” ▲
- Dacă tocmai ați setat o blocare cu parolă, trebuie să introduceți parola în acest moment.
- După o încărcare cu succes, PuTTYGen va afișa informații legate de cheie.
第 5 步 :Faceți clic pe butonul Salvare cheie privată pentru a salva formatul de fișier cheie privată disponibil pentru PuTTY ▼
Cum se configurează Putty?
Următorul este să setați Putty să se conecteze cu cheia privatăLinuxMetoda serverului:
第 1 步 :Putty → Sesiune: completați numele gazdei (sau adresa IP)
第 2 步 :Putty → Conexiune → Data: Completați numele de utilizator pentru autentificare automată: root
第 3 步 :PPutty → Conexiune → SSH → Auth: Selectați fișierul cheie privată tocmai generat de PuTTYGen în fișierul cheie privată pentru autentificare ▼
第 4 步 :Reveniți la Putty → Session: Saved Session, completați numele pentru a salva, apoi faceți dublu clic pe nume pentru a vă conecta direct.
第 5 步 :Vă puteți conecta la Linux fără o parolă în viitor; vă rugăm să nu uitați să salvați fișierul cheie privată.
Pentru a obține software-ul instrument Linux de conectare la distanță pe telefoanele mobile Android, vă rugăm să faceți clic pe acest link pentru a vizualiza ▼
Lectură suplimentară:
Hope Chen Weiliang Blog ( https://www.chenweiliang.com/ ) a distribuit „Nu se poate conecta la Vultr VPS SSH? Metoda de setare a generarii cheilor PuTTY", vă va ajuta.
Bine ați venit să distribuiți linkul acestui articol:https://www.chenweiliang.com/cwl-646.html
Bun venit pe canalul Telegram al blogului lui Chen Weiliang pentru a primi cele mai recente actualizări!
📚 Acest ghid conține o valoare uriașă, 🌟Aceasta este o oportunitate rară, nu o ratați! ⏰⌛💨
Distribuie si da like daca iti place!
Partajarea și like-urile tale sunt motivația noastră continuă!